Serena Flores

Love what you read?
Send a small one-off tip
Humans and AI: Where’s the Line?
8 months ago
Detroit: Become Human, released on May 25, 2018, is a video game based off of a short film that was made back in 2012 called “Kara.” This short film took place in what could’ve been assumed to be a fa...